YouTube Movies for Rent Now Available in The UK
YouTube first announced videos for rent in the US back in May, and it has brought Americans full-length feature films readily available for streaming. Some of the titles have behind the scenes footage on top of the movie itself, and you can watch movies you rent on any device you own. Each movie costs $2.99, and can be watched unlimited times the duration of your rent.

After the US, the feature rolled out to neighboring country Canada. And now, the feature landed in the other side of the pond – the UK. Full-length feature count is currently over a thousand. It’s not the largest archive, but not bad for a service that only started out.

Of course, those with video streaming services might find little need for this YouTube feature, especially since those services can cost as little as $8 a month for unlimited streams. Still, YouTube shows some new movies not yet available on some streaming services, so if you’re the type who can’t wait, you might get tempted every once in a while.
